Job Description Summary
The Senior Administrative Specialist will provide general administrative support for complex and time sensitive projects by supporting the manager and employees of a diverse department through a variety of tasks related to organization and communication. The duties and responsibilities performed will often require independent judgment and strong organizational.
Job Description
Essential responsibilities include, but are not limited to:
+ Performs general administrative duties such as receive fax/letters, answer routine questions, locate and furnish information, organize and maintain files, order supplies, maintain regulatory posting notices, and follow up on pending matters.
+ Proactively supports a manager and team by prioritizing and completing multiple activities; typically, within deadlines.
+ Maintains and submits regulatory facility licenses, renewals, modifications, permits, and supporting licensing documents for various agencies.
+ Perform administrative tasks utilizing a high level of accuracy and attention to detail as facility licensing administration requires frequent correspondence to industry regulators.
+ Develops, distributes and files memos, letters, presentations, and regulatory documents such as inspection reports, certificates, orders, and correspondence.
+ Provides support and logistics for regulatory inspections.
+ Manage and analyze business data, including data monitoring, tabulation skills, generation of data, text and graphics for reports and presentations.
+ Appropriately handles routine inquiries and exercises appropriate judgment in escalating issues to team members or managers as needed.
+ Prioritizes, organizes, and follows-through on assignments in a timely manner.
+ Prepares and distributes routine reports following established procedures and protocols.
+ Maintains and coordinates calendars, schedules meetings and appointments.
+ Works closely with other administrative positions in a collaborative manner, including occasional coverage for others during absences.
+ Frequently works on complex projects
+ Utilize specialized office equipment such as VoIP telephone, teleconference hook-up, and multifunction printers to complete tasks
+ Accurately maintains electronic databases, files, shared virtual drives and other information repositories.
+ Maintains control of company proprietary, security and other sensitive information
+ Operate computer systems and programs such as Microsoft Office, Adobe or similar program
+ Work overtime as needed
+ Perform other relevant duties as assigned
Minimum Qualifications:
+ High School Diploma/GED or equivalent and Minimum of three years of Administrative/secretarial experience (includes positions such as office manager, secretary, administrative assistant, paralegal or equivalent).
+ OR a certification/degree from a secretarial program and Minimum of one year of Administrative/secretarial experience (includes positions such as office manager, secretary, administrative assistant, paralegal or equivalent).
